Age | Commit message (Collapse) | Author | |
---|---|---|---|
2018-08-03 | chcleanup: Consider _$CARCH deps | Luke Shumaker | |
Also, don't parse PKGBUILD ourself; use .SRCINFO to extract information from the PKGBUILD. | |||
2018-06-02 | librechroot: Properly clean up temporary pacman.conf file | Luke Shumaker | |
2018-06-02 | librechroot: Remove the hack for -any packages differing between arches | Luke Shumaker | |
db-import-pkg now makes sure that that doesn't happen. | |||
2018-05-30 | libremakepkg: Fix it_fails_with_bad_signaturesv20180530 | Luke Shumaker | |
libremakepkg defined a cleanup() function, which overrode common.sh:cleanup(), which meant that common.sh:die() exited with a '0' status. | |||
2018-05-30 | libremakepkg: Fix it_succeeds_with_good_signatures | Luke Shumaker | |
Do this by syncing makepkg_args with makechrootpkg's default_makepkg_args; recent devtools have makechrootpkg not copy the keyring in to the chroot. This incorporates 3 commits from Arch devtools: 7ca4eb82d (2017-05-02): add --holdver 0cbc179d2 (2017-07-13): use long options; `-s`→`--syncdeps`, `-L`→`--log` 75fdff181 (2017-07-13): add --skipinteg | |||
2018-03-27 | Makefile: Use files.groups instead of nested.subdirs to split the package | Luke Shumaker | |
2018-03-24 | Makefile: Support split libdir / libexecdir | Luke Shumaker | |
I intend to have xbs-abs have separate libdir / libexecdir s. | |||
2018-03-24 | librechroot: Add Andreas Grapentin to the copyright statement. | Luke Shumaker | |
This should have been in 314f2c9b1daac8c47d78754569a7310d0b77e22b. | |||
2018-03-20 | make librechroot target arch agnostic | Andreas Grapentin | |
in the light of my attempts to create a riscv64 parabola port, I would like to see the following changes made to librechroot. The patch removes the hard-coded arm cross arch checks in favour of a more general approach, that works for more architectures. As a side effect, this now also would behave correctly when creating x86 chroots on arm, although why anyone would choose to do this is beyond me. Reviewed-By: Luke Shumaker <lukeshu@parabola.nu> [LS: Added quotes] | |||
2018-01-03 | update for new devtools | Luke Shumaker | |
2018-01-03 | libremakepkg: usage: mention copying in the GnuPG pubring | Luke Shumaker | |
2018-01-03 | libremakepkg: consistent tense in usage text bullets | Luke Shumaker | |
2018-01-02 | Change my email address lukeshu@sbcglobal.net -> lukeshu@parabola.nu | Luke Shumaker | |
2018-01-02 | librechroot: Update binfmt_misc check for qemu-user-static-binfmt | Luke Shumaker | |
2018-01-02 | librechroot: Add comments about where config changes come from | Luke Shumaker | |
This has been sitting uncommitted in my checkout for a while. This has been sitting uncommitted in my checkout for a while. | |||
2017-07-08 | librechroot: Respect the -n flag (fixes test) | Luke Shumaker | |
2017-07-04 | librechroot: make sure that makepkg.conf is always parsed as textv20170705 | Luke Shumaker | |
https://lists.parabola.nu/pipermail/dev/2017-June/005576.html | |||
2017-05-25 | start moving things to use the libremessages exit codes | Luke Shumaker | |
2017-05-24 | Merge conf.sh:load_files and conf.sh:check_vars into load_conf | Luke Shumaker | |
2017-05-05 | libremakepkg: update usage() text | Luke Shumaker | |
2017-05-04 | random tidy up | Luke Shumaker | |
2017-05-04 | shellcheck directives | Luke Shumaker | |
2017-05-04 | bugfix [2/2]: libremakepkg: hooks-distcc: Fix for the basic smoke test. | Luke Shumaker | |
2017-05-04 | distcc-tool: reformat a comment | Luke Shumaker | |
2017-05-04 | distcc-tool: use `jobs` instead of trying to track PIDs manually. | Luke Shumaker | |
The old way fails in weird ways if a process dies early. | |||
2017-05-04 | distcc-tool: use SO_REUSEADDR for listening on TCP sockets | Luke Shumaker | |
2017-05-04 | chroot-tools: tidy shebangs of library files | Luke Shumaker | |
2017-05-01 | Clean up argument parsing for libremessages formatters. | Luke Shumaker | |
2017-04-20 | Don't use subshells in local/export/declare commands. | Luke Shumaker | |
Only make this change in places where it shouldn't make a difference, and something weird has to be going on for the subshell to fail. This is on par with checking the return value of malloc. We don't need tests for each of these failure cases. | |||
2017-04-20 | Variables inside of $((...)) don't need a $ in front of them. | Luke Shumaker | |
These were found with the help of shellcheck. | |||
2017-04-20 | Quote unquoted strings that should probably be quoted. | Luke Shumaker | |
These were found with the help of shellcheck. Nothing more complicated than wrapping a variable in double quotes has been done. | |||
2017-04-11 | libremakepkg: Tidy. | Luke Shumaker | |
2017-04-11 | librechroot: Update for new sync_chroot usage. | Luke Shumaker | |
I changed how it works in devtools-par. | |||
2017-04-11 | librechroot: Load makechrootpkg.sh into the main process. | Luke Shumaker | |
makechrootpkg.sh has now been patched to make it ok with `set -euE`. | |||
2017-04-11 | librechroot: Tidy up. | Luke Shumaker | |
2017-04-11 | chcleanup: Fix typo in a comment | Luke Shumaker | |
2017-04-11 | Update for new devtools version | Luke Shumaker | |
2017-04-11 | libremakepkg: correctly exit if a hook fails | Luke Shumaker | |
2017-04-11 | Expect devtools files to already be patched. | Luke Shumaker | |
2017-01-30 | Update and tidy the build system for autothing v3. | Luke Shumaker | |
2017-01-29 | makechrootpkg.sh.patch: Update to latest devtools-par master. | Luke Shumaker | |
2016-06-09 | Update to a version of devtools based on 20160527.1 | Luke Shumaker | |
2016-06-09 | Work with the new version of autothing. | Luke Shumaker | |
2016-05-23 | librechroot: give a better error if an invalid -A flag is given | Luke Shumaker | |
2016-05-11 | librechroot: Don't use the host CacheDir for ARM chroots on x86 hosts.v20160511 | Luke Shumaker | |
2016-05-11 | librechroot: tidy qemu-arm check | Luke Shumaker | |
2016-05-11 | Update arch-nspawn.patch to latest devtools commit. | Luke Shumaker | |
Also, move the nosetarch check to reduce the possibility of conflicts in the future. | |||
2016-05-11 | Fix `-s` flag to turn off setarch -> ↵ | André Fabian Silva Delgado | |
https://lists.parabola.nu/pipermail/dev/2016-May/003992.html | |||
2016-05-10 | librechroot: Revert running arch-nspawn and mkarchroot in subshells.v20160510 | Luke Shumaker | |
It screws with the exit status. Instead, take advantage of dynamic scoping to avoid mutating arch_nspawn_flags (the reason I switched them to subshells). | |||
2016-05-09 | librechroot: give a good error message if binfmt_misc isn't configured | Luke Shumaker | |